The Meall Ghaordaidh (also known as Meall Ghaordie ) is a 1039 meter high mountain in Scotland . Its Gaelic name probably means hill of the shoulder or hill of the arm . It is located northwest of Killin on the border between the Council Areas Perth and Kinross and Stirling in the extensive mountain landscape between Glen Lyon in the north and Glen Lochay in the south.

From the south, the Meall Ghaordaidh is a little more conspicuous, characterized by broad grassy slopes, which does not stand out from its lower neighbors. To the north, on the other hand, the mountain ends in two parallel ridges that end in steep cliffs towering over Glen Lyon. Directly north of the summit, one of the two ridges runs out into the Creag Loaghain . To the east of this rises the wall of the Creag at Tulabhain , connected to the highest point by a wide ridge that runs first to the east and then to the north. The horseshoe-shaped valley of the Allt Loaghain , a mountain stream flowing into the River Lyon , opens up between the two rock faces . To the west lies another rock face, the Creagan at t-Sluic, on the north side of the Meall Ghaordaidh.

The Meall Ghaordaidh is usually climbed from the south. Here the ascent leads over the less prominent, grassy south-east shoulder of the mountain. The starting point is a small car park in Glen Lochay, shortly after the settlement of Duncroisk on the bridge over the Allt Dhuin Croisg .
